Sterling Bio to acquire gelatin company in China

Mumbai: Pharmaceutical company Sterling Biotech Ltd is acquiring China Gelatin Ltd in an all-cash deal.

The acquisition would enable the company to tap new growth markets in the Far East, including China, Sterling Biotech informed the Bombay Stock Exchange. China is amongst major consumers of gelatin globally and this acquisition would be the first overseas one by Sterling Biotech, the company said in its filing with the BSE.

The transaction would be completed upon receipt of all necessary government approval under applicable laws by each party, the company further said.

Sterling Biotech Ltd, the largest manufacturer of gelatin has undertaken expansion of Rs236 crores. The gelatin demand in domestic market to grow by 15 per cent while globally the growth to be around 3 per cent.

The company reported net sales of Rs276.6 crore the six months ended June 2006 with net profit of Rs2.2 crore.
